From 1ea2e757f7cba714eefd27efb2f9285078bba4a3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Anton Khirnov Date: Wed, 24 Jan 2024 10:42:13 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] fftools/ffmpeg_filter: do not end filtering when a graph input EOFs There may be other inputs or sources in the filtergraph. Propagate the EOF to the scheduler and continue filtering.
